The Importance of the Transmission Control Solenoid Valve
Automatic transmissions are complex systems requiring precise control to operate effectively. The Transmission Control Solenoid Valve is integral to this process as it regulates the flow of transmission fluid. This fluid pressure directly influences the shifting of gears. When the Transmission Control Solenoid Valve malfunctions, it can lead to erratic shifting, slipping, or complete transmission failure, making it essential for vehicle owners to understand its functionality and maintenance requirements.
How the Transmission Control Solenoid Valve Works
At its core, the Transmission Control Solenoid Valve consists of an electromagnetic coil that can open or close a valve based on commands from the vehicle's Engine Control Unit (ECU). When the ECU detects a need for shifting based on various parameters such as speed, throttle position, and engine load, it sends an electrical signal to the solenoid. This action opens or closes the valve, allowing transmission fluid to either engage or disengage clutches and bands, which determines the gear ratio applied to the wheels.
Common Issues and Troubleshooting
There are several common issues that can arise with the Transmission Control Solenoid Valve, leading to performance concerns. Symptoms such as harsh shifting, delayed engagement, or warning lights on the dashboard can indicate potential problems. Diagnosing these issues often involves checking for error codes, inspecting the electrical connections, and examining the transmission fluid for contaminants. Regular maintenance, including fluid changes and inspections, can prevent many of these issues from escalating into major repairs.
